Symptoms
These symptoms are all common in people with Crohn's disease, a chronic inflammatory bowel disease that affects the digestive tract. Abdominal pain is often the most bothersome symptom, but diarrhea, weight loss, and fatigue can also significantly impact a person's quality of life.
- Abdominal pain is typically felt in the lower abdomen and can range from mild to severe. It may be worse after eating or when under stress.
- Diarrhea is another common symptom of Crohn's disease. It can be watery or bloody and may occur several times a day.
- Weight loss is often unintended and can be a sign of malabsorption, which occurs when the body is unable to absorb nutrients from food.
- Fatigue is a common symptom of Crohn's disease and can be caused by a number of factors, including inflammation, anemia, and malnutrition.
These symptoms can all have a significant impact on a person's life. Abdominal pain can make it difficult to work or go to school. Diarrhea can lead to dehydration and electrolyte imbalances. Weight loss can lead to malnutrition and anemia. Fatigue can make it difficult to perform everyday activities.
If you are experiencing any of these symptoms, it is important to see a doctor to rule out Crohn's disease or other underlying medical conditions.

Challenges
Fatigue, nausea, and vomiting are all common challenges for people with Crohn's disease, a chronic inflammatory bowel disease that affects the digestive tract. These symptoms can significantly impact a person's quality of life, making it difficult to work, go to school, or participate in other activities.
- Fatigue is one of the most common symptoms of Crohn's disease. It can be caused by a number of factors, including inflammation, anemia, and malnutrition. Fatigue can make it difficult to perform everyday activities, such as working, going to school, or taking care of oneself.
- Nausea is another common symptom of Crohn's disease. It can be caused by inflammation of the stomach and intestines. Nausea can make it difficult to eat and drink, which can lead to weight loss and malnutrition.
- Vomiting is a less common symptom of Crohn's disease, but it can be very debilitating. Vomiting can lead to dehydration and electrolyte imbalances, which can be dangerous if not treated.

FAQs on Liam Charles' Illness
This section provides answers to frequently asked questions about Liam Charles' illness, Crohn's disease. These questions aim to address common concerns and misconceptions surrounding the condition.
Question 1: What is Crohn's disease?
Answer: Crohn's disease is a chronic inflammatory bowel disease that can affect any part of the digestive tract, from the mouth to the anus. It causes inflammation and irritation of the digestive tract, leading to a range of symptoms such as abdominal pain, diarrhea, weight loss, and fatigue.
Question 2: What are the symptoms of Crohn's disease?
Answer: The symptoms of Crohn's disease can vary depending on the severity of the condition and the location of the inflammation. Common symptoms include abdominal pain, diarrhea, weight loss, fatigue, fever, blood in the stool, and mouth sores.
It's important to note that Crohn's disease is a complex condition, and its symptoms and management can vary from person to person. If you suspect you may have Crohn's disease, it's essential to consult with a healthcare professional for proper diagnosis and treatment.
